Question to the Department for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s:

To ask the Secretary of State for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s, what has been the average time taken to respond to public inquiries by her Department in each of the last five years; and whether she plans to introduce measures to improve those times.

Defra has not issued a response to any public inquiry that has concluded within the last five years.

Public inquiries are an important mechanism to allow the Government to learn lessons for the future. Defra takes recommendations from public inquiries seriously and recognises the importance of taking time to thoroughly consider its response.
